East Wilder Neighborhood Overview
East Wilder is a quiet, residential neighborhood located in the northeastern corner of Concord, New Hampshire. It offers a blend of suburban comfort and convenient access to the amenities of the state capital.
Housing & Real Estate
The neighborhood primarily features single-family homes, many with spacious yards, reflecting its established character. With a median home value of approximately $233,800, it represents a more affordable entry point into the Concord housing market.
Schools & Education
Students in East Wilder are served by the Concord School District. The neighborhood is zoned for well-regarded schools like the Mill Brook School and Concord High School, providing strong educational options from elementary through graduation.

Who Lives Here
The neighborhood is home to a mix of families, professionals, and long-time residents. With a median household income around $70,598, it is a solidly middle-class community that values its peaceful, family-friendly atmosphere.
